We are currently recruiting for an experienced Operations Director for our schools catering business across the primary, secondary and college sectors across Cheshire, Staffordshire and West Midlands. As Operations Director, you will be responsible for delivering against our KPIs - Health and Safety, Retention, Quality and Finance. You will be expected to have the confidence and credibility to lead your teams and create strong client relationships, as well being commercially astute. You should be able to demonstrate evidence of supporting and developing a growing team, encouraging them to succeed and help you achieve your objectives. You will remain calm and focused, showing leadership and strength appropriate for your role as Director. If you believe in People, Perception, Passion, and Pride to grow our business this could be the position you are looking for.

Caterlink is committed to safeguarding and promoting the welfare of children and vulnerable adults and expects all employees to share this commitment. An enhanced DBS disclosure will be obtained for this role. Salary dependant on experience.
